Potatoes Are The #1 Pick For Favorite Healthy BBQ Side Dish

quick__healthy_classic_potato_salad_copyright

DENVER (July 2, 2012)—With summer BBQ season underway, and the ultimate BBQ holiday just days away, Americans across the country have pronounced potato salad their No. 1 pick among healthy BBQ side dishes. According to a poll on CookingLight.com, potato salad is the favorite healthy summer side, surpassing other traditional sides like coleslaw, pasta salad and baked beans.

Whether you prefer a traditional potato salad or a twist on the traditional, the United States Potato Board (USPB), representing the nation's 2,500 potato growers, has your Fourth of July BBQ potato salad recipe covered.

The USPB's Quick & Healthy Classic Potato Salad recipe is a healthy spin on the traditional American side dish and is ideal for serving alongside just about any summertime entree, from chicken and fish, to Fourth of July favorites, such as hot dogs and burgers. By using nonfat plain yogurt instead of mayonnaise, this potato salad has just 180 calories and zero fat per serving.

For a twist on the traditional, try the USPB's Roasted Fingerling Potato Salad with Lemon & Thyme for a salad that is colorful, bursting with citrus flavor and has just a hint of creaminess. This salad, created for the USPB by Laura Bashar of www.familyspice.com/, packs 110 percent of your daily value of vitamin C in just a single serving and 81 milligrams of potassium.

How can something so delicious also be so packed with nutrition? It's the potato, of course! At just 110 calories, the base of America's favorite vegetable side dish is packed with essential vitamins and minerals.  One medium-size (5.3 ounce) skin-on potato boasts more potassium than a banana and almost half your daily value of vitamin C (45%), and absolutely no fat, sodium or cholesterol.
